1、光耦正常工作:光耦是一种光电转换器件,可以将输入信号转换为输出信号。当输入信号存在时,光耦中的发光二极管会发出红外线,照射到光敏二极管上,产生电流输出,从而导致输出端口出现微小的电压。
2、端口未正确配置:如果单片机的端口未正确配置或者未设置为输入模式,可能会导致输出端口出现异常电压。
3、其他因素:还可能存在其他因素导致输出端口出现异常电压,如单片机供电异常、线路接触不良等。
4、检查光耦是否正常:可以通过测试光耦的输入和输出端口,确认光耦是否正常工作。如果光耦工作正常,则可以排除光耦引起的异常电压。
5、配置端口为输入模式:在程序中对相应的端口进行配置,确保端口设置为输入模式,避免因端口配置错误导致异常电压。
6、检查线路连接:检查单片机和光耦之间的线路连接是否良好,避免线路接触不良导致异常电压。
7、检查单片机供电:如果单片机供电异常,可能会导致输出端口出现异常电压。可以检查单片机的供电电压是否稳定,避免供电不稳定导致异常电压。
免责声明:本平台仅供信息发布交流之途,请谨慎判断信息真伪。如遇虚假诈骗信息,请立即举报
举报